QUESTION: Does تحية المسجد require a specific intention? or is it sufficient if I go in a masjid and pray 2 rakahs of between adhaan and iqaamah without thinking about تحية المسجد

QUESTION: Does تحية المسجد require a specific intention? or is it sufficient if I go in a masjid and pray 2 rakahs of between adhaan and iqaamah without thinking about تحية المسجد

30 Sep

ANSWER:

No specific intention is required. Any 2 rakah you pray would suffice.
